The Pursuit of Love boasts a stellar cast bringing the novel by Nancy Mitford to life. Written and directed by Emily Mortimer, The Pursuit of Love is a satire of British aristocracy set in the 1930 and 1940s. The 3-episode miniseries premiered on BBC in May 2021 and it streams on Amazon Prime Video starting July 30, 2021.

The Pursuit of Love centers on Linda Radlett (Downton Abbey's Lily James) and her cousin Fanny Logan (Emily Beecham), who also serves as the narrator of the story. Best friends since childhood, Linda and Fanny want a grander life beyond the stuffy walls of Alconleigh, Linda's ancestral home. They get their chance to break free when they enter adulthood, which means finding a proper husband and raising a family according to the rules of the British aristocracy. But Linda has her own dreams of finding her ideal of love and it leads her to live a dramatic and tumultuous life. Meanwhile, Fanny can only watch from the sidelines and pick up the pieces for Linda as she struggles with her own choices in life.

Lily James as Linda Radlett

Lily James as Linda Radlett in The Pursuit of Love

An incurable romantic, Linda Radlett is The Pursuit of Love's main character. Although sheltered and uneducated, Linda upends her life and those around her as she pursues her idea of what a life of love means. Lily James played Lady Rose in Downton Abbey and starred in the films Cinderella, Baby Driver, and Mamma Mia! Here We Go Again. Next, James will portray Pamela Anderson in the upcoming miniseries Pam & Tommy.

Emily Beecham as Fanny Logan

Pursuit of Love Fanny

Fanny is The Pursuit of Love's narrator and Linda's cousin. Fanny is fascinated by Linda's adventurous life as "a bolter" while she laments her own sense of responsibility as "a stayer". Beecham appeared as The Widow in Into The Badlands and stars in Hail Caesar!, Daphne, and Netflix's Outside The Wire.

Andrew Scott as Lord Merlin

Lord Merlin Pursuit of Love

Having portrayed a hot priest in Fleabag season 2, the terrifying Moriarty in Sherlock, and the villainous C in SpectreAndrew Scott now takes a turn as Lord Merlin. A wealthy neighbor to the Radletts, Lord Merlin is eccentric and irascible but he takes an interest in Linda's well-being as a society beauty.

Dominic West as Uncle Matthew Radlett

The Pursuit of Love

Uncle Matthew, Lord Alconleigh, is Linda's bullying and closed-minded father. Matthew hates foreigners and educated women, which is why he refused to school Linda and his other daughters. West first rose to fame as Detective McNulty on HBO's The Wire and, more recently, has gained plaudits for his performance as Noah Solloway in The Affair. As for West's future roles beyond Uncle Matthew, he will next portray Prince Charles in The Crown season 5.

John Heffernan as Davey Warbeck

The Pursuit of Love Davey

Davey is Fanny's uncle who raised her along with his wife, Emily. A distinguished writer and critic, Davey is also a hypochondriac who consumes endless remedies for his various ailments. Heffernan appeared in season 2 of The Crown and he played Jonathan Harker in Netflix's Dracula.

Shazad Latif as Alfred Wincham

pursuit of love - alfred

Alfred Wincham becomes Fanny's husband. An Oxford scholar, Alfred quietly suffers as Fanny pays more attention to spending her time admiring Linda and her adventures than minding and working on her marriage. Latif played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de in Penny Dreadful but he may be best known for portraying the dual role of the Klingon Voq and Lt. Ash Tyler on Star Trek: Discovery.

Dolly Wells as Aunt Sadie Radlett

Pursuit of Love Aunt Sadie

Aunt Sadie is the wife of Matthew Radlett and Linda's mother, although she is often too passive a matriarch and doesn't stand up to Lord Alconleigh's bullying. Wells appeared alongside Lily James in Pride and Prejudice and Zombies and she played Sister Agatha in Netflix's Dracula.

Assaad Bouab as Fabrice de Sauveterre

Lily James as Linda Radlett in The Pursuit of Love

Fabrice de Sauveterre is a French duke and one of the most infamous men in Paris during World War II. Fabrice takes an instant shine to Linda and becomes her patron and lover. Bouab is best known for his roles in Homeland and Messiah.

Freddie Fox as Tony Kroesig

The Pursuit of Love

Tony Kroesig is the first object of teenage Linda's desires and he becomes her husband. But soon, Linda grows bored of Tony, a conservative with political views she considers dull. Fox appeared in King Arthur: The Legend of the Sword and Hulu's The Great. He also played Mark Thatcher opposite Gillian Anderson as Margaret Thatcher in season 4 of The Crown.

Emily Mortimer as The Bolter

The Bolter Pursuit of Love

The Bolter is the name given to Fanny's mother because of her lifelong habit of abandoning her responsibilities to her children and dashing off to have torrid affairs with men. The Bolter periodically returns to Fanny's life, unapologetic about her absences. Mortimer wrote and directed The Pursuit of Love and she is known for her roles as Phoebe in 30 Rock and Mackenzie McHale in The Newsroom.

Other Characters In The Pursuit of Love

The Pursuit of Love Lord Merlin Party

Beattie Edmonson as Louisa Radlett: Louisa is the eldest Radlett daughter and Linda's dependable and proper older sister who remained at Alconleigh to raise her family. Edmonson has appeared in numerous UK productions like Marley's Ghost, Patrick, and Upstart Crow.

James Frecheville as Christian Talbot: Christian becomes Linda's second husband and she becomes fascinated by his Communist worldview, eventually following him to Europe. Frecheville played Buster on New Girl, Patrick in Transparent, and he will appear in Peaky Blinders season 6.

Annabel Mullion as Aunt Emily Warbeck: Emily is Sadie Radlett, Lady Alconleigh's, sister who raised Fanny with her husband Davey. Mullion appeared in the original Mission: Impossible film as well as Breathless and Midsomer Murders.

Martha West as Jassy Radlett: Linda's younger sister, Jazzy collects "running away" money since she was a child and eventually runs off to America. The Pursuit of Love is one of West's first screen roles but she also played Annie Darwin in the 2009 movie Creation.

Sam Nivola as Matt Radlett: Matt is Linda's younger brother who eventually runs away from Eton College to fight in the Spanish Civil War. Nivola is Emily Mortimer's son who also appeared alongside her mother in Doll & Em before she cast him in The Pursuit of Love.
